A chemical compound containing two hydroxyl groups attached to aromatic rings, used in chemical synthesis and industrial processes.
From 'di-' (two) and 'phenol' (an aromatic compound with a hydroxyl group). The term describes molecules with two phenolic functional groups.
Diphenols are the starting materials for making some plastics and resins—two hydroxyl groups give these molecules the ability to 'hold hands' with other chemicals and form long chains!
